platelet 6-phosphofructokinase (phosphofructokinase 1, phosphohexokinase, phosphofructo-1-kinase isozyme C, PFK-C, 6-phosphofructokinase platelet type, PFKP, PFKF)

Function: - 6 phosphofructokinase is a tetramer in muscle is M4, liver is L4, & red cell is M3L,M2L2, or ML3 - a subunit composition with a higher proportion of platelet type subunits is found in platelets, brain & fibroblasts - carbohydrate degradation, glycolysis - D-glyceraldehyde 3-phosphate & glycerone phosphate from D-glucose: step 3/4 - allosteric enzyme activated by ADP, AMP, or fructose bisphosphate & inhibited by ATP or citrate Cofactor: Mg+2 Structure: - tetramer - belongs to the phosphofructokinase family, 2 domains subfamily
